National Volunteer Week

April 15-21, 2012

Canadians have a rich history of volunteering and community involvement. Volunteers are on the front lines of all of our community services - community health care, heritage and arts, maintenance of green space, disaster relief, volunteer firefighting, minor sports - the list is endless. The work of the volunteer is essential. National Volunteer Week (NVW) pays tribute to the millions of Canadian volunteers who donate their time and energy.

NVW is the biggest celebration of volunteers and volunteerism this country has and Volunteer Canada is taking the lead on the celebrations again this year.

April 15-21 is the revised date for National Volunteer Week 2012. Our priority is to ensure that Canadian volunteers are the national focal point during NVW. As such, the date change was made to avoid overlap with other holidays that fall within the same time frame. This update has been adopted by both Volunteer Canada and its American affiliate, Points of Light Institute. NVW was originally slated for the third week in April.
